Police Investigating KFC-Taco Bell Drive-Thru Burglary

Per MCPD: “Detectives from the Montgomery County Department of Police – 3rd District Investigative Section are investigating a burglary that occurred on Monday, October 30, 2023, in the 7700 block of Blair Road in Silver Spring (Takoma Park). Detectives have released surveillance video of the male suspect and are asking for the public’s assistance in identifying him.


At approximately 9:09 a.m., 3rd District officers responded to the location for the report of a burglary. The investigation by detectives has revealed that at approximately 5 a.m., an adult male suspect forcibly opened the drive through window of the restaurant, reached in with his arms, stole merchandise and left the scene.

Detectives reviewed the surveillance video of the restaurant and obtained a description of the suspect.  The suspect is described as a Black male, approximately 30-years-old, and wearing a red jacket.
